Save Money

This is a year-round goal we are pretty sure that everyone sets themselves however, it is much harder than it looks! With bills to pay, families to look after and everything else that life throws at you – saving can be difficult.

One of the best ways to save money without thinking is by putting your loose change to good use. Buy a money pot and whenever you end up with coins – even if they’re copper! Add them into your coin jar – because every little helps! Take a look at these money jars. Another popular way to save that has been in the media recently is the 365-day money saving challenge. By using this saving method you could save £1500 by the end of 2020 without even noticing. On a Monday you put away £1, Tuesday £2, Wednesday £3 and so on. Collectively by the end of the year, you will of saved £1500 by adding just a few pounds each day.

Healthy Eating

One of the most popular new year resolutions every year. Healthy eating doesn’t only aid in losing weight, it promotes a healthier lifestyle and improves well being. You are what you eat! And that tired, sluggish feeling after eating a greasy or unhealthy meal is a perfect example of this.

With veganism being such a huge topic at the moment, people are trying to incorporate veganism into their everyday lives. This can simply mean cutting down on dairy and meat products rather than completely abolishing them. So keep this in mind as you go into the new year, there are plenty of health benefits to cutting down on meat and substituting it for something else, so this might be something to keep in mind.

If veganism isn’t your style, there are still plenty of ways you can eat healthier this year. With diets, increasing your water intake and reducing the amount of bad stuff you put in your body you will feel a dramatic change. A popular way to incorporate fruit and vegetables into your diet if you don’t particularly like them is with smoothies. Smoothies can be a mixture of fruit and vegetables and are a great way to get veggies into your diet if you don’t like them. Adding kale or spinach to your smoothies doesn’t change the taste but means you get veg into your diet without having to actually eat it.
